Vapor barrier installation services involve the strategic placement of moisture-resistant barriers within building structures to prevent the infiltration of water vapor. Typically, these barriers are installed in areas prone to moisture accumulation, such as crawl spaces, basements, and under concrete slabs. The process generally includes assessing the property's specific needs, preparing the surface, and securely laying down the vapor barrier material to create a continuous moisture barrier. Proper installation ensures that water vapor does not condense within walls or floors, helping to maintain a dry interior environment.

One of the primary issues vapor barrier installation addresses is the prevention of mold growth and wood rot caused by excess moisture. When water vapor seeps into building materials, it can lead to structural damage over time and compromise indoor air quality. Installing a vapor barrier helps mitigate these problems by controlling moisture levels, thereby reducing the risk of mold, mildew, and decay. It also contributes to better energy efficiency, as dry insulation and structural elements perform more effectively, potentially leading to lower heating and cooling costs.

The overview below groups typical Vapor Barrier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Cedar Lake, IN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material Costs - The cost of vapor barrier materials typically ranges from $0.20 to $0.50 per square foot, depending on the type and quality selected. For a standard basement, material expenses can vary from $200 to $500.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project needs.

Labor Expenses - Installation labor generally costs between $0.50 and $1.00 per square foot. For an average basement, total labor charges could fall between $300 and $1,000. Prices may fluctuate based on the complexity of the installation and local rates.

Total Project Costs - Overall expenses for vapor barrier installation often range from $500 to $2,000 for typical residential spaces. Larger or more complex areas may incur higher costs. Contact local service providers for precise quotes tailored to specific projects.

Additional Fees - Some projects may include extra costs such as surface preparation or repairs, which can add $100 to $300. These fees vary depending on existing conditions and the scope of work involved. Local contractors can assess and provide detailed cost estimates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a vapor barrier? A vapor barrier is a material installed to prevent moisture from passing through walls, floors, or ceilings, helping to control humidity and prevent mold growth.

Where can vapor barriers be installed? Vapor barriers can be installed in basements, crawl spaces, attics, or any area prone to moisture buildup.

What materials are used for vapor barriers? Common materials include polyethylene plastic sheeting, foil-backed membranes, and specialized vapor-retardant paints.

How long does vapor barrier installation typically take? Installation times vary depending on the area size and complexity but generally can be completed within a day or two.
